I dove into the game almost without thinking. I began upgrading and making new structures like any standard RTS. The deviate from the rule being that you can only build or upgrade one thing at a time. Also, the higher the level building you are upgrading, the longer it takes to build each time. This involves a BUNCH of waiting around for stuff to be built. For example: when I first started the buildings were taking anywhere from 45 seconds to 3 minutes to build. Now, if I want to upgrade my castle walls it's going to take 3 hours and 36 minutes.

Resources in the game are Gold, Food, Lumber, Stone and Iron. You begin with a supply of each, with more rolling in all the time. The amount that comes in depends on how many resource gathering nodes you have built and the level you have upgraded them to. When I say "all the time" I mean precisely that. The game is like an MMO in that there is a persistent world where things happen regardless of whether or not you're logged on.

It is a multiplayer game and it throws you randomly onto a large map filled with other kingdoms. You are given a "beginner buff" which makes it so you have seven days where people cannot attack you. You can voluntarily give up this buff and go to war whenever you wish. I have not checked out much of the multiplayer aspect as I am making full use of the time you are given to build yourself up. The makers of this game sell "coins" in exchange for real money. These "coins" enhance the game in various ways. You can make your army have more attack power or defensive power for 24 hours, or complete a structure instantly with the coins. I have not found that I wish to throw down my hard earned cash for these little advances yet. The screen they have set up for purchasing the coins is silly. There is a drop down menu for how many USD in exchange for cents Civony game coins. People read "30 USD in exchange for 300 cents Civony game coins".
